Making Your Own Family Tree!
The main thing is not to complicate it.
Keep the craft side of it simple, the importance is the topic.
We made a small family tree up to the childrens Great-Grandparents.
On a large sheet of paper we made a tree out of brown tissue paper.
We talked about family relationships and words like, siblings and aunts and uncles and who theirs were.
Another aspect of our conversations touched on immigration, language and culture.
